2016-05-24 3 views
-1

Ich bin neu in der Programmierung und neu in GitHub. Ich mache gerade meinen Praktikanten in einer Schulabteilung. Ich habe heute einige js-Plugins installiert und festgestellt, dass ich einige der anderen js-Dateien gelöscht haben könnte. Dann habe ich beschlossen, einfach die .cshtml- und .css-Dateien zu kopieren, an denen ich gearbeitet habe, und alle anderen Änderungen zu speichern. Ich war dumm genug, um eine Kopie meiner .css-Datei zu vergessen und alle Änderungen sind verloren.Ich habe versehentlich alle meine Änderungen "verstaut". Wie rolle ich zurück?

Gibt es trotzdem einen "Git Stash" Befehl umzukehren?

+0

'Git Stash Pop'? – jonrsharpe

+2

'git stash --help'? –

Antwort

3

Git Stash ist im Wesentlichen ein Stapel von nicht festgeschriebenen Änderungen. git stash (oder vollständiger, git stash save) verschiebt den aktuellen Satz nicht festgeschriebener Änderungen auf den Stapel. Das Gegenteil wäre, git stash pop zu verwenden, um sie zu Ihrem Arbeitsverzeichnis zurückzugeben.

+0

Manchmal vergessen Sie, Ihre Taschen zu öffnen. Sie können überprüfen, wie viele Taschen Sie haben, indem Sie> "git stash list" eingeben. – Ola

3

während git stash pop funktioniert, können Sie auch in Betracht ziehen, git stash apply zu verwenden. Überprüfen Sie this question für weitere Details

Verwandte Themen